A major nuclear company seeks an experienced Audit and Certification Manager to manage compliance audits and certifications like ISO 19443. The role requires a strong technical background, knowledge of regulatory standards, and the ability to lead and mentor a team of auditors.
Candidates should have:
- A degree in engineering
- SC Clearance or capability to obtain it
- Experience in highly regulated industries
This position offers a dynamic environment focusing on safety and quality in nuclear operations.
